Transaction 576bd61645e2e24d0e2d7a4691b053cce4e189e1e18fd64741b979bc519317b7

1 Input
1 Outputs
  • 576bd61645e2e24d0e2d7a4691b053cce4e189e1e18fd64741b979bc519317b7:0
  • value  173687
    address  1QCVWx8kyg7SELd9dmgbzvqMrxMKUZrT1T